INGREDIENTS

4 ounces white fish fillet (Tilapia)

1 medium green banana (approx. 150g)

1 small yam (approx. 150g)

1/2 cup cooked pinto beans (approx. 130g)

1 cup mixed steamed vegetables (approx. 150g)

PREPARATION

  • 1

    Prepare all ingredients by rinsing and lightly scrubbing produce. Peel the green banana and yam.

  • 2

    Fill a pot with water and bring to a boil. Add the green banana and yam, and boil until tender (approximately 15-20 minutes). Remove and set aside.

  • 3

    Steam the fish fillet by seasoning lightly with salt, pepper, and a squeeze of lemon if desired. Place in a steamer basket and steam for about 8-10 minutes or until the fish flakes easily with a fork.

  • 4

    In a separate steamer or using a steaming insert, steam the mixed vegetables for about 5-7 minutes to maintain their bright color and crunch.

  • 5

    Heat a small pot and gently warm the cooked pinto beans if necessary.

  • 6

    Plate the steamed fish alongside slices of boiled green banana and yam. Add the pinto beans and finish with a generous serving of the steamed vegetables.

  • 7

    Garnish with fresh herbs like cilantro or parsley for added flavor and serve immediately.
